Asbaranpur
Asbaranpur is a village located in Kerakat tehsil of Jaunp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Kerakat (tehsildar office) and 30km away from district headquarter Jaunpur. As per 2009 stats, Asbaranpur village is also a gram panchayat.

About Asbaranpur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Asbaranpur is 203177. The village spans a total geographical area of 335.44 hectares. Kerakat is nearest town to Asbaranpur village for all major economic activities.

Population of Asbaranpur
Below is a concise population overview of Asbaranpur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,650 | 1,249 | 1,401 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 398 | 207 | 191 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 955 | 460 | 495 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 1,509 | 833 | 676 |
Illiterate Population | 1,141 | 416 | 725 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Asbaranpur village:
- The total population of Asbaranpur village is around 2,650, including approximately 1,249 males and 1,401 females, with a sex ratio of 1121 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 398 children aged 0–6 years in Asbaranpur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Asbaranpur village has 955 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Asbaranpur village is about 56.94%, with male literacy at 66.69% and female literacy at 48.25%.
- There are around 448 households in Asbaranpur village.
Connectivity of Asbaranpur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Asbaranpur. As per the 2011 stats, Asbaranp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available |
